How Much Is 4.3 Pounds of Coconut Oil in Pints?
4.3 pounds of coconut oil equals 4.47 pt. Coconut oil has a density of 218g per cup. A lighter ingredient like flour (125g/cup) would fill more volume at the same weight, which is why ingredient-specific conversions matter.
Formula and Step-by-Step
- Start with 4.3 pounds of coconut oil
- Convert pounds to grams: 4.3 × 453.59 = 1,950.45g
- 1 cup of coconut oil = 218g
- 1,950.45g ÷ 218g/cup = 8.95 cups × 0.5 = 4.47 pints
The same formula works for any amount. Multiply (or divide) by the density, then convert units as needed.

Understanding the Units
What is a Pound?
A pound (lb) is a US customary unit of weight equal to 453.592 grams or 16 ounces. It is used for larger quantities of ingredients like flour, sugar, and meat.
What is a Pint?
A US pint equals 473.176 ml, 2 cups, or 16 fluid ounces. It is used for liquids, ice cream, and other volume measurements in American cooking.
